Changing the Game by Jim Host

A memoir of the extraordinary professional life of the pioneer in college sports marketing.
Jim Host is founder of Host Communications, Inc., a nationally renowned college sports marketing and association management company. He grew up in Kentucky and played baseball at the University of Kentucky before joining the Chicago White Sox farm system. Host served as the first executive director of Rupp Arena, founding chairman of the Kentucky Horse Park Commission, chairman of Louisville Arena Authority, and secretary of commerce for Kentucky. He received the Kentuckian of the Year Award from the Chandler Foundation, the Champion of Diversity Award from the Louisville Urban League, the Kentucky Broadcasters Distinguished Kentuckian Award, and honorary doctorates from the University of Kentucky, the University of Pikeville, and Kentucky State University. Eric A. Moyen is associate professor and department head of Educational Leadership at Mississippi State University. He is the author of Frank McVey and the University of Kentucky: A Progressive President and the Modernization of a Southern University.
